小程序开发制作技巧
1. 学习基础知识:首先,你需要了解小程序的基本概念、功能和特点。这包括了解小程序的运行环境、开发语言(如JavaScript、WXML、WXSS等)、框架(如Taro、WePY等)以及开发工具(如微信开发者工具)。
2. 熟悉开发环境:安装并熟悉小程序开发工具,如微信开发者工具,以便进行代码编写、调试和预览。
3. 学习小程序组件:掌握常用的小程序组件,如页面、导航、布局、图片、文本等,以便快速构建小程序界面。
4. 学习数据绑定:学习如何将数据与页面元素进行绑定,实现数据的实时更新和展示。
5. 学习事件处理:学习如何响应用户操作,如点击、滑动等,以及如何触发相应的事件处理函数。
6. 学习状态管理:学习如何使用全局变量、闭包等方式实现小程序的状态管理,以便于在不同页面之间共享数据。
7. 学习网络请求:学习如何发起网络请求,获取服务器端的响应数据,并将其传递给小程序。
8. 学习样式设计:学习使用CSS样式表来美化小程序界面,包括颜色、字体、间距等。
9. 学习性能优化:学习如何优化小程序的性能,减少加载时间,提高用户体验。
10. 学习版本控制:学习使用Git等版本控制系统,对小程序代码进行版本管理和团队协作。
打造个性化平台应用
1. 确定目标用户:分析目标用户的需求和喜好,以便为小程序提供有针对性的功能和服务。
2. 设计主题风格:根据目标用户的审美和习惯,设计小程序的主题风格,使其具有独特性和吸引力。
3. 添加个性化功能:根据目标用户的兴趣爱好,添加一些个性化的功能,如推荐系统、社交互动等。
4. 优化用户体验:关注用户在使用过程中的体验,不断优化小程序的操作流程、界面设计和交互效果。
5. 增加互动性:通过游戏、抽奖、答题等形式增加小程序的互动性,提高用户的参与度和粘性。
6. 扩展功能模块:根据用户需求,逐步扩展小程序的功能模块,如购物、预约、支付等。
7. 持续迭代更新:定期对小程序进行更新和维护,修复bug,添加新功能,以满足用户需求的变化。
8. 营销推广:通过社交媒体、广告投放等方式进行小程序的推广,吸引更多的用户关注和使用。
9. 数据分析:收集和分析小程序的数据,了解用户行为和需求,为后续的优化和升级提供依据。
10. 反馈与改进:积极听取用户的反馈意见,及时进行改进和优化,提升小程序的整体质量和竞争力。